General description

1-Dimethylamino-2-propanol (1DMA2P, DMAPH), a tertiary amine, is a dimethylamino-alcohol having high boiling point. It is a potent protector against mechlorethamine cytotoxicity and inhibitor of choline uptake. Kinetics of homogeneous reaction of carbon dioxide (CO2) with 1-dimethylamino-2-propanol in water has been investigated using stopped-flow technique.

Application

1-Dimethylamino-2-propanol solution may be used in the synthesis of the following:
  • novel unsymmetrical 2,3,9,10,16,17,23-heptakis(alkoxyl)-24-mono(dimethylaminoalkoxyl)phthalocyanine compounds
  • homoleptic nickel(II) aminoalkoxide
  • Adduct with cobalt(II) 2,4-pentanedionate (acac)
